CANACONA

Canacona Railway Stop Bachao Action Committee (CRSBAC) has decided to give a call for Rail–Roko in Canacona, if the contentious issue of providing ‘Halts’ to long-distance trains and related facilities is not extended to Canacona Railway Station in the next 15 days.
The decision came after CRSBAC members attended a joint meeting with Railway Officers as brokered by Canacona Mamlatdar on Thursday.
As assured during the January 13 ‘hunger strike’ by CRSBAC members at Canacona KRC Station, a joint meeting was held at Canacona Mamlatdar Office on Thursday, attended by Regional Railway Manager (KRCL) Balasaheb Nikam, Sr Regional Traffic Manager Sunil Nadkar, Canacona Mamlatdar Manoj Korgaonkar, Canacona PI Chandrakant Gawas and a horde of CRSBAC members led by coordinator Janardhan Bhandari and Convenor Shantaji Naik Gaonkar.
Agitating members narrated the sacrifices made by Canconcars who gave their land and spearheaded counter-movements to support the railway line through Canacona as well as various other reasoning and justifications for resuming the halts and railway services as existing pre-Covid lockdown.
In response, the officers reiterated that the Railway Board will be notified about the demands, which incidentally the KRC officials have been telling the protestors since they began the agitation on December 15, 2022.
The reply led to the CRSBAC members walking out of the meeting in protest. Later speaking to media, they blamed the railway officials for keeping the Railway Board and the Railway Ministry in the dark over the demands and indicated Canconcars will have to resort to Rail-Roko, if suitable solutions don’t come within 15 days.
"Senior citizens took part in the morcha against the railways, they gave representations as well, and still the matter is not reached to the level of Railway board is an overall insult to Canacona people," said former CMC Chairperson Rajendra Dessai.
CRSBAC Coordinator Janardhan Bhandari said, "We will not take this type of delaying tactics, which are not in good taste and insulting as well. If Railways continue to ignore our rightful and legitimate demand for long-distance Train Halts and other related matters in Canacona KRC Station for the next 15 days, CRSBAC will not lag behind to give a Rail-Roko Call, for which the authorities and government will be responsible."
